  6. Exactly, Mrs. Crossfire!!!! This is what the detective KNOWS. But she can't yet PROVE it. Trying to gather evidence in order to establish this truth if the entire reason for the trap. This goes right back to the legal theory of "plausible deniability" (a term Gideon himself used.) Even if something is true (Gideon rejecting Eva had all been a lie) if the cops cannot present evidence to prove that, then by default Gideon can deny it's true. Right now, all Detective Graves has is a look of anguish on Gideon's face Saturday morning, and the fact Gideon had dinner with Eva's roommate and her father Friday night. This goes up again against press photos that could counter "prove" that even before Nathan died, Gideon was already done with Eva and was now seeing his ex fiancee who very publicly left her husband in France, moved all the way back to New York, and in front of a high society crowd at a fundraising dinner snagged Gideon right out from under Eva's nose. In fact, one of those photos shows Gideon partying with Corrine the same night "someone" killed Nathan. Plus it looks like we're about to get even more convincing proof - Eva "cheated" on Gideon with Brett, and right after that, Gideon dumped her and immediately decided to give Corrine another shot. All of that went down when Nathan was still very much alive. Even more crucial Mrs. Crossfire is your observation above: "Eva telling her (Detective Graves) she broke up with him Saturday surely helped put a sticker on it" (Meaning Graves found out for certain it was Eva dumping Gideon AFTER Nathan was dead and Gideon being shattered about it, not the other way around -- Gideon rejecting Eva almost a week before the murder (i.e. the night of the concert when he caught Eva in Brett's arms.) Graves made a HUGE mistake that could cost her the whole case when she tricked Eva into confirming it was true Eva dumped Gideon on Saturday. 

    • When she approached Eva to set Eva (and Gideon) up by spilling the beans, the very first thing Eva said was she didn't want to talk (i.e. answer any questions) without a lawyer.
    • So Graves said she was going to do all the talking -- Eva could just listen. Which actually does not violate Eva's rights.
    • BUT Graves slipped over the important line when she ASKED Eva, "You broke up with him on the Saturday after we interrupted your dinner, didn't you." Eva nodded yes.
    • Right then and there, because Graves was winging it and pushing hard, she crossed a line into violating Eva's right to have a lawyer present for questioning, a right Eva was careful to remind Graves of upfront.
    • That "nod yes" now potentially is inadmissible as evidence. And if the prosecutor in the case recognizes that right away (or a judge throws it out of evidence) not only is that nod "yes" now poison -- every later piece of evidence Graves might now get as a direct result of Eva's nod is also poison. The whole trap itself might end up infected by legal poison. There's a legal phrase "fruit of the poisoned tree."
